I got a call today from a reporter for the AP. He's doing an article on the
Wichita football team plane crash that one of my books describes. The 40th anniverary is coming up. He found my book on amazon and called to ask some questions. He said he'd plug the book in his article. Might add some credibility to my credentials even though I was only the editor and wrote the foreword. He's going to send a link when it comes out maybe this week or next. AP goes everywhere. This could be good exposure.
